Bold measures The Government of Sri Lanka introduced a number of bold macroeconomic stabilisation measures in February/March 2012. These were necessary as the country was on a trajectory to a very destructive balance of payments crisis. It is still too early to determine whether enough has been done to stabilise the balance of payments, particularly ...

Role of infrastructure Development economists and agencies have considered infrastructure and human resource development to be at the centre of the development process. Infrastructure refers, in this note, to physical structures, such as roads, electricity, irrigation, water and sanitation and telecommunication.
